Financial Investment and Payment Options

Affordable Tuition Structure

Pulse Radiology Institute offers straightforward and affordable tuition for Sparta, MI students, with total program costs of $23,250 that includes complete academic components and materials needed for comprehensive program completion. Our structured payment system starts with a manageable $100 registration fee and a reasonable $5,000 down payment, followed by manageable monthly payments of $900 for the duration. This financial plan allows Sparta, MI students to complete their education debt-free, eliminating the financial burden that often accompanies standard college programs. The graduation fee of $150 is due before degree conferral, completing the total educational investment.

Choosing a career as a radiologic technologist is more than just a practical move—it’s a path that blends job stability, financial reward, and the satisfaction of making a difference in patients’ lives. Radiologic technologists are essential members of the healthcare team, working closely with patients and operating advanced imaging equipment like X-ray machines to help diagnose conditions ranging from bone fractures to lung disease.

The career offers more than just a sense of purpose. It’s also one of the most promising professions when it comes to salary and career growth opportunities.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the average annual salary for radiologic technologists is about $73,410, with the potential to earn significantly more by advancing into specialized areas such as MRI or CT.

But here’s the thing—your salary won’t be the same across the board. Factors like education, years of experience, specialty, and even geographic location all play a role in shaping your earning potential. Let’s break down the most important elements that influence pay and explore how you can maximize your income in this rewarding field.


Education: Radiography vs. MRI

One of the first big decisions in this field is whether to pursue general radiography or jump straight into an advanced imaging modality like MRI. Education is a huge salary driver, and the difference between entry-level radiography and MRI certification can be substantial.

For example, in 2023, MRI technologists earned an average annual salary of $83,740, compared to $73,410 for radiologic technologists overall. That’s a notable jump—and it underscores how valuable advanced training can be.

Experience: Building Confidence and Value

While education lays the groundwork, real-world experience sets you apart. Employers place a premium on technologists who can handle patients with empathy, adapt in emergencies, and navigate complex imaging situations with confidence.

The difference shows up in salary too. Experienced technologists often earn higher pay because their skills reduce errors, improve patient outcomes, and add efficiency to healthcare teams.

Specialization: Expanding Into High-Demand Modalities

In medical imaging, the more you specialize, the more valuable you become. Employers often look for technologists who can work across multiple modalities—MRI, CT, or breast sonography—because it gives their facilities greater flexibility.

Certain specialties also come with higher pay. For instance, breast sonography is in growing demand, while MRI consistently remains one of the most financially rewarding imaging careers. If salary growth is one of your top priorities, pursuing advanced certifications in high-demand areas is a smart move.
